Determining the volume of items in cubic feet is essential for moving estimations. This process often involves using online tools or manual calculations (length x width x height) to assess the space belongings will occupy in a moving truck or storage unit. For example, a sofa measuring 6 feet long, 3 feet wide, and 3 feet high occupies 54 cubic feet.

Measuring Regular Items
Standard rectangular items like boxes and bookshelves are measured by multiplying length, width, and height. For example, a box 2 feet long, 1 foot wide, and 1.5 feet high has a volume of 3 cubic feet. Consistent units (feet, inches, etc.) are essential for accurate calculations.
-
Handling Irregular Shapes
Furniture with irregular shapes, such as sofas or armchairs, presents a greater challenge. Breaking down these items into smaller rectangular sections for individual measurement offers greater accuracy. Alternatively, estimating the overall dimensions by considering the largest points can provide a reasonable approximation.

3. Moving Truck Sizes
Moving truck sizes are intrinsically linked to the concept of cubic feet calculations for moving. Accurate volume estimation, often facilitated by online calculators or manual methods, directly informs the appropriate truck size selection. This connection is crucial for cost-effectiveness and logistical efficiency. Underestimating volume can lead to insufficient space, necessitating multiple trips or last-minute, potentially more expensive, arrangements. Conversely, overestimating may result in unnecessary expenses for a larger truck than required. For instance, a studio apartment move might require a 10-foot truck (around 450 cubic feet), while a three-bedroom house could necessitate a 26-foot truck (approximately 1,600 cubic feet). 4. Storage Unit Dimensions
Storage unit dimensions are a critical factor when calculating cubic footage for moving and storage. Understanding the available space within various storage unit sizes and matching it to the calculated volume of belongings ensures efficient use of resources and prevents unnecessary expenses. A direct correlation exists between accurate volume calculations and the selection of appropriately sized storage units. For example, if an individuals belongings occupy 500 cubic feet, renting a 5×5 unit (typically 125 cubic feet) would be insufficient, necessitating a larger unit like a 10×10 (typically 1000 cubic feet). This illustrates the cause-and-effect relationship between calculated volume and storage unit selection. Overlooking this connection can lead to inadequate storage space, requiring additional units and increased costs, or wasted expense on a larger unit than necessary.

Practical Tips for Volume Calculations
These practical tips offer guidance on accurately calculating cubic footage for moving, ensuring efficient planning and resource allocation.
Tip 1: Consistent Units: Employ consistent units throughout the measurement process. Mixing feet and inches introduces errors. Convert all measurements to a single unit (e.g., feet) before calculating volume.
Tip 2: Account for Packing Materials: Packing materials, especially for fragile items, increase overall volume. Factor in the additional space occupied by packing materials when estimating total cubic footage.
Tip 3: Breakdown Complex Shapes: Deconstruct irregularly shaped items into smaller, rectangular components for more accurate measurement. This methodical approach improves the precision of volume estimations.
Tip 4: Visualize Placement: Consider how items will be placed in the moving truck or storage unit. Strategic arrangement can optimize space utilization. Visualizing this arrangement informs more realistic volume calculations.
Tip 5: Leverage Online Tools: Utilize online cubic feet calculators to streamline the calculation process and minimize mathematical errors. These tools offer efficient volume calculations and often include helpful features like inventory management.
Tip 6: Overestimate Slightly: Slightly overestimating total volume provides a buffer for unforeseen circumstances or variations in packing efficiency. This precautionary approach minimizes the risk of running out of space.
Tip 7: Consult Professional Movers: For complex moves involving large or unusually shaped items, consulting professional movers is advisable. Their expertise ensures accurate estimations and efficient logistical planning.
